The procedure to apply for Ph.D. in law may vary depending on the university or institution. However, here are some general steps that are usually involved:
1. Research the universities or institutions that offer Ph.D. in law: Look for universities or institutions that offer Ph.D. programs in law and conduct research on their admission requirements, faculty, research areas, and other relevant information.
2. Check the eligibility criteria: Before applying for a Ph.D. in law, check the eligibility criteria for the programme, such as minimum educational qualifications, minimum marks required, and other requirements.
